WebChase and other credit card issuers (like BofA, Citi, Discover, Capital One, HSBC) will offer what is called re-aging to account holders that participate in long term repayment plans. This is when your credit card is enrolled in an internal repayment plan, or as part of a consumer credit counseling services plan.
